I am looking at Spanish 16 gauges and and have been talking to LCS about ordering a Ugartachea 257 16 ga. from them. Unfortunately, I am too far away to get there to handle one. I read a generally favorable review of a new Ugartachea 16 gauge sidelock but it suggested that the gun was not very lively in its handling. This may be a "your mileage may vary" thing, but I would be interested in hearing whether others here have any experience with this.
I was also looking at the Grade V that LCS is offering but I like the round body of the 257 and am not sure that you get that much more for the extra cost of the Grade V.
